This is an excellent song.
"We build ourselves, where monsters used to hide."
I have a couple of opinions on this. I think this line either means that humans can do horrible things, but have the ability to put those events in the past and make an entirely new life. Or, this line can be taken in an almost cynical sense, saying we are all monsters because we are all capable of destruction and terror. However, once again, humans have the ability to repress cruelty either genuinely or behind a false front.
"Oh, how we celebrate the mediocrity."
Wow. This is probably one of the most underappreciated lines written by Chiodos. So here's my rant-
The meaning of this is so true, especially in the world today. Just about every human being is taught from birth to strive for what is considered to be a 'purposeful' or 'fulfilling' life. This 'ideal life' basically includes completing school, obtaining a six figure job, getting married, having children, and living in a big house with a white picket fence. This is what is expected from us, even though, (surprise), there can be so much more to life.
Everyone claims to support expression and creativity. But guess what? Society looks down on homeless people, people who live in their cars, aspiring musicians and artists, people who work in certain industries, and everyone else who doesn't want to live out the 'American Dream'. That is the definition of hipocracy. Maybe these people just want to live for themselves, live for something greater than everyone else's expectations. Unoriginality and mediocrity are very much celebrated in our world. Anyone who thinks differently is kidding themselves.
